Property prices in Soing-Cubry-Charentenay
The average price per square metre of built property in Soing-Cubry-Charentenay (Département 70) is 1,000 €/m² – median from 39 actual sales (DVF 2023–2024).
Price trend
From 2023 to 2024 property prices have fallen by 48% (1,299 €/m² → 673 €/m²).

Frequently asked questions
How much does property cost per m² in Soing-Cubry-Charentenay?
The average price per square metre of built property in Soing-Cubry-Charentenay is 1,000 €/m² (median from 39 sales, DVF 2023–2024). The middle 50% of sales were between 512 €/m² and 1,579 €/m².
